Revolutionizing Learning & Training in Hospitals and Healthcare: Monetizing AI-Generated Content on YouTube
In recent years, we have witnessed a rapid advancement in artificial intelligence (AI) and its applications across various industries. One area where AI is making significant strides is in the realm of learning and training. With the advent of AI-generated content, hospitals and healthcare institutions have an incredible opportunity to revolutionize their training programs and leverage the power of YouTube to monetize these educational resources.
Traditionally, the process of creating learning and training materials in hospitals and healthcare settings has been time-consuming and resource-intensive. Experts in the field often spend countless hours developing content, creating videos, and conducting training sessions. However, with the emergence of AI, this process can be streamlined and automated, allowing for the creation of high-quality learning materials in a fraction of the time.
AI-generated content refers to the use of machine learning algorithms to create videos, presentations, and other educational resources. These algorithms can analyze large amounts of data, including medical textbooks, research papers, and clinical guidelines, to generate accurate and informative content that is tailored to the specific needs of healthcare professionals.
YouTube, being one of the largest video-sharing platforms globally, provides an ideal platform for hospitals and healthcare institutions to distribute and monetize these AI-generated learning and training videos. By uploading these videos to YouTube, hospitals can reach a vast audience of medical students, residents, and healthcare professionals around the world.
Monetizing AI-generated content on YouTube can be achieved through various means, including advertisements, sponsorships, and partnerships. Hospitals and healthcare institutions can collaborate with pharmaceutical companies, medical device manufacturers, or other relevant stakeholders to generate revenue streams from their educational content. Additionally, YouTube's ad revenue sharing program allows content creators to earn money based on the number of views and engagement their videos receive.
The benefits of using AI-generated content for learning and training in hospitals and healthcare are numerous. Firstly, it allows for standardized, evidence-based education that can be easily updated as new research and guidelines emerge. This ensures that healthcare professionals are equipped with the latest knowledge and skills necessary to deliver high-quality care.
Secondly, AI-generated content can be tailored to the specific needs of different healthcare professionals. Whether it's a video on a surgical technique, a case study on a rare disease, or a simulation of a clinical scenario, AI can generate content that caters to the diverse learning styles and preferences of medical professionals.
Furthermore, by leveraging YouTube's monetization features, hospitals and healthcare institutions can generate revenue that can be reinvested into further improving their training programs. This could include developing more advanced AI algorithms, expanding the range of educational content, or enhancing the overall learning experience for healthcare professionals.
However, it is important to note that while AI-generated content can offer numerous benefits, it should not replace the importance of hands-on training and mentorship in healthcare. The practical application of skills and the guidance of experienced professionals are essential for ensuring the highest standards of patient care. AI-generated content should be viewed as a complementary tool that enhances traditional learning and training methods.
